matla App.design 存圖
时间: 2023-07-31 21:03:59 浏览: 39
如果你想在Matlab中把图片存储到App.design中,可以使用以下代码:
``` matlab
% 创建一个app
app = uifigure;
% 创建一个按钮
btn = uibutton(app, 'push', 'Text', 'Save Image', 'Position', [100 100 100 22]);
% 设置按钮的回调函数
btn.ButtonPushedFcn = @(~, ~) saveImage(app);
function saveImage(app)
% 获取当前的图像
img = getframe(app);
% 存储图像到App.design中
imwrite(img.cdata, 'appdesign://myimage.png');
end
```
这段代码创建了一个按钮,当按钮被按下时,会把当前的图像存储到App.design中。你可以将`myimage.png`替换为你想要的文件名。
相关问题
matlab app design- 简单的函数表达式运算
MATLAB App设计是一种用于创建交互式计算机应用程序的强大工具。它可以帮助开发人员快速设计和构建符合特定需求的应用程序,使用户能够进行各种计算和数据处理操作。
对于简单的函数表达式运算,MATLAB App设计可以提供简洁而直观的界面,让用户能够轻松输入和计算各种函数表达式。在设计中,我们可以为用户提供一个文本框,用于输入函数表达式,以及若干个按钮,用于进行不同的运算。
在设计过程中,我们可以使用MATLAB的数学函数库,例如sin、cos、sqrt等,来处理用户输入的函数表达式。此外,我们还可以添加错误检查机制,以确保用户输入的表达式是有效的,并提供错误提示信息。
在应用程序的界面上,我们可以显示函数表达式的计算结果,以及可能的图形化表示。其中,结果可以显示为一个文本框或一个图形窗口,这取决于具体的需求。
在实际使用中,用户可以通过输入函数表达式并点击相应的按钮来实现特定的运算。例如,用户可以输入一个简单的数学表达式,如 "sin(x) + cos(x)",然后点击计算按钮。应用程序将解析表达式并计算结果,将其显示在界面上。
MATLAB App设计可根据具体的需求进行扩展和定制,以满足更复杂的应用场景。我们可以添加更多的计算功能,例如求导、积分等,或者提供额外的数据输入和输出选项,以使应用程序更加灵活和实用。
综上所述,MATLAB App设计是一种强大的工具,可以帮助我们设计简单的函数表达式运算应用程序。通过提供直观的界面和丰富的计算功能,它可以帮助用户轻松进行各种函数表达式的计算和数据处理操作。
gui界面设计和matlab中appdesign有什么区别
GUI界面设计和Matlab中的App Designer都是用于创建用户界面的工具,但是它们之间有以下区别:
1. GUI界面设计通常使用Visual Studio、Eclipse等集成开发环境(IDE)中的图形界面设计器来创建用户界面,而App Designer是Matlab中的一个工具箱,可以直接在Matlab中创建用户界面。
2. GUI界面设计可以使用多种编程语言来实现,如Java、C#等,而App Designer主要使用Matlab语言来实现。
3. GUI界面设计可以创建独立的应用程序,而App Designer主要用于创建Matlab应用程序的用户界面。
4. GUI界面设计可以通过使用第三方库和控件来拓展其功能,而App Designer只能使用Matlab内置的控件和函数。
总之,虽然GUI界面设计和App Designer都是用于创建用户界面的工具,但它们的使用方式和适用范围略有不同。